Mum & son get own place after years stuck in housing crisis
THE Home Rescue team tonight help out a mother and son who have finally got their own home after years being stuck in the housing crisis.
Determined duo Margaret Pierce and her son Shane are like two peas in a pod in their bright and airy fourth-floor apartment in Dublin's Rathfarnham.
But they had to overcome many challenges to finally get a place of their own, including living for years in a mobile home and then in emergency accommodation - one of Ireland's many hidden homeless families.
Margaret - who has colitis, a chronic medical condition - says autistic Shane, 12, is "the apple of my eye".
They were delighted to get their own two-bed place in the Scholarstown area in 2019 after such a housing struggle.
But since then, they've clung on to the bags and baggage from their old life, and their house is cluttered and chaotic.
They need the help of builder Peter Finn and designer Dee Coleman to make their home functional and relaxing.
